Transaction 32e22787be0827c016ae60fd9685ebc6d4c47b05300a4d72e062778cc87c8128

1 Input
2 Outputs
  • 32e22787be0827c016ae60fd9685ebc6d4c47b05300a4d72e062778cc87c8128:0
  • value  66627290
    address  12iG4NTTEUdK6JbFARTbDLfYY14bfcEiWm
  • 32e22787be0827c016ae60fd9685ebc6d4c47b05300a4d72e062778cc87c8128:1
  • value  1136236
    address  1LqgxXcN3vmfEvWNpKh97UXBHtQ992duaL